Swaalina, whose birth name is Halina Kuchey, is a Finnish model, singer, and social media personality. She shot to fame in Indian entertainment after starring in Jass Manak’s popular Punjabi music video “Prada.” This boosted her popularity among music lovers. With a unique style and fun personality, she stands out in the fashion and music industry. Born on July 1, 1995, in Finland, Swaalina comes from a creative and supportive family. She went on to earn a Master’s in Theater Studies, which helped her to develop her understanding of performance and visual storytelling. After completing her education, she developed a passion for acting, modeling, and stage arts; ultimately enough for her to pursue a career in Indian entertainment.
Swaalina was inspired to move to India so she could be involved in the Indian entertainment industry because of her love of Indian culture. Additionally, her ability to speak many different languages (including Hindi and Punjabi) has given her the opportunity to connect with people from many different regions.
Journey into Modeling and Entertainment

Swaalina first modeled in the 2017 Hindi music video “Ik Kahani.” Her role in the Punjabi song “Prada” in 2018 made her famous. It was a huge success, exposing her to many fans. The following was a series of roles for her through popular music videos in Punjabi, such as “Suit Punjabi,’ “Viah,” “Billian Billian,” “Perfect,” and “Mutiyar.” Swaalina became an iconic figure in the Punjabi music industry for her elegant screen presence and authentic appearance. She has represented many leading brands in television/digital advertisement campaigns such as Tata Tea, Kurkure, Nescafé, Sunsilk, and Snapdeal.
Expanding into Music

Swaalina has branched out further by making some music as well; she has released various songs of her own, such as Alvida, IDAF, Nasha, and Dooriyan, which have all shown off the creative side of Swaalina. She has shown that she is multi-talented by being willing to take on different creative roles throughout the years.
Personal Life and Interests

As of January 2025, Swaalina is married to rapper/musician Emiway Bantai. Their relationship was very popular among the fans because of both their passion for music and creativity.
When not working, she enjoys reading, travelling, yoga, cooking, dancing, and ice skating. She loves to learn about new cultures and has a positive attitude toward life.
